Stereolab is a UK-based band whose style, mixing 1950s-1960s pop and loungemusic with the "motorik" beat of krautrock, was one of the first to which the term " post-rock" was applied. They are noted for the use of vintage keyboard instruments like Moog synthesizers and Vox and Farfisa organs. Stereolab is also notable for founding their own record label, Duophonic Records, with a grant from UK charity The Prince's Trust. The band is often referred to as "The Groop" by their fans (and in the title of their song "The Groop Play Chord X" on the album Space Age Bachelor Pad Music). They were founded in 1990 by songwriters (guitar, keyboards), formerly of the band McCarthy, and Laetitia Sadier(sometimes credited as Seaya Sadier; vocals, keyboards, trombone, guitar), who is from franceand sings in both English and French.
